Objectives

  • The course aims at:• Enabling learners to communicate in simple situations, master the basics of English, understand the main ideas of complex text, a wide range of demanding, longer texts and recognize implicit meaning• Providing students with the required knowledge and skills along with necessary vocabulary and grammar lessons which enrich his linguistic competence to interact with a degree of fluency and spontaneity that makes regular interaction with native speakers quite possible without strain for either party. • Offer them with a comprehensive overview of different writing techniques. • Producing clear, well-structured, detailed text on complex subjects, showing controlled use of organizational patterns, connectors and cohesive devices. • Preparing the students for the International Exams such as IELTS, TOEFL and Cambridge English Exams: KET, PET, FCE, CAE and CPA• Provide material for practice in all areas of the test.

Outcomes

By the end of this course, students should be able to:• approaching and locating written and visual information• skimming, scanning and detailed reading and analysis skills Techniques in reading questions and recognizing paragraph structures• Identify alternative meanings and distracting information• Understanding visual information and essay writer's views and arguments• Vocabulary building• Developing and presenting arguments• Organizing and expressing facts, opinions, arguments and supporting information• Structure and organization of essay• Describing trends and processes• Taking part in discussion and expressing opinions• Comparing and contrasting information

Course Contents

This course offers students complete, official preparation for the Cambridge English: KEY (KET), Preliminary (PET) and First (FCE). The course combines solid language development with systematic and thorough exam preparation and practice. The course also offers material provides students with an overview of the IELTS and TOEFL exams.
